Some integrative doctors may determine that low levels of glutathione may be related to potential health issues, anxiousness, trouble sleeping, everyday stress, and metabolic issues.* Diet is, as always, an important first step in boosting and maintaining glutathione levels by eating foods high in the precursors of selenium, sulfur, zinc, and alpha lipoic acids.* Cruciferous vegetables (kale, arugula, broccoli, cauliflower, cabbage), liver, beef, oysters and other seafood, eggs, and Brazil nuts are examples of foods rich in these nutrients.* Supplementing directly with glutathione can be tricky, as not all forms are well absorbed.* Until now, most practitioners have recommended liposomal glutathione delivery or other pure glutathione products
